Introduction

Effective training programs for kitchen staff and industrial workers are crucial for workplace safety, yet they significantly differ in focus, content, and execution. Comprehending these distinctions is essential for developing tailored training solutions that address the specific hazards faced in each industry, thereby enhancing overall safety and compliance.

Focus on Specific Hazards in Kitchen and Industrial Environments

Safety training protocols are meticulously crafted around the distinct risks inherent to each work environment. In kitchens, typical hazards encompass heat exposure, sharp tools, and risks of food contamination. Conversely, industrial workplaces primarily address hazards related to machinery operation, chemical exposure, electrical risks, and the management of heavy equipment.

  • Kitchens emphasize safety protocols focused on safe food handling, fire prevention strategies, and techniques to prevent cross-contamination.
  • Industrial training prioritizes the safety measures of machine operations, hazardous materials management, and the correct use of personal protective equipment (PPE).

Diverse Methods of Safety Training Implementation

The methodologies employed to deliver safety training vary considerably between kitchens and industrial settings. In kitchen environments, training is predominantly hands-on, allowing staff to practice safety protocols in real-time during food preparation and cooking. In contrast, industrial training typically integrates both theoretical concepts and practical applications, utilizing approaches like simulations, interactive modules, and regular safety drills.

  • Culinary training frequently involves real cooking scenarios to reinforce safety in food preparation and compliance with food safety regulations.
  • Industrial safety training may include classroom learning followed by practical demonstrations with machinery, along with the use of virtual reality training for high-risk operations.
